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67 39790317 72921579 271 338
9431 85985
9431 85985
25115 91838 52627816227 54
All about undefined
Interested in learning more?
9431 85985
25115 91838 52627816227 54
See more
323 95 7335695443
087 165907869 85
See more
4855034802 510042
759 81365 129825 93
See more